Hi there, I am facing a disgusting problem. While I am trying to update my system using update manager It downloaded the files and then while it starts installation it shows the following message


(Reading database ... 60%dpkg: unrecoverable fatal error, aborting:
files list file for package 'linux-libc-dev' is missing final newline
E: Sub-process /usr/bin/dpkg returned an error code (2)
A package failed to install. Trying to recover

And then nothing occurs.

I had to add that i had been faced a bit different problem earilier. And using the following code I solved that:


sudo mv /var/lib/dpkg/updates/0103 /home/shaquille/dpkg_update_0103


sudo mv /var/lib/dpkg/updates/010 /home/shaquille/dpkg_update_0104


sudo mv /var/lib/dpkg/updates/0105 /home/shaquille/dpkg_update_0105


sudo mv /var/lib/dpkg/updates/0106 /home/shaquille/dpkg_update_0106


sudo mv /var/lib/dpkg/updates/0107 /home/shaquille/dpkg_update_0107


sudo mv /var/lib/dpkg/updates/0108 /home/shaquille/dpkg_update_0108

and then:


sudo dpkg --configure -a

The problem was solved then.

But now with this problem what can i do?
